
Microsoft has addressed a significant security vulnerability in Power Pages (CVE-2025-24989) that could allow attackers to bypass authentication controls. This critical flaw in Microsoft's low-code website development platform highlights the growing security challenges in enterprise SaaS solutions.
Understanding CVE-2025-24989
The vulnerability, discovered by security researchers at CyberArk Labs, involves improper access control implementation in Power Pages. Attackers could exploit this flaw to:
- Gain unauthorized access to sensitive business data
- Modify website content without proper authentication
- Potentially escalate privileges within the Power Platform environment
Microsoft rated this vulnerability as Important with a CVSS score of 8.1, noting that exploitation requires specific preconditions but could lead to significant data exposure.
Technical Breakdown
The flaw stems from how Power Pages handles session validation during API requests. Researchers found that:
- The platform didn't properly validate user sessions for certain administrative functions
- API endpoints were vulnerable to parameter tampering attacks
- Certain role-based access controls could be bypassed through crafted requests
"This vulnerability demonstrates how seemingly minor implementation flaws in complex SaaS platforms can create major security gaps," explained security analyst Maria Chen.
Impact on Organizations
Power Pages hosts over 2 million business websites globally, making this vulnerability particularly concerning for:
- Financial institutions using Power Pages for customer portals
- Healthcare organizations handling PHI data
- Government agencies with public-facing forms
- Any business using Power Pages for sensitive data collection
Microsoft's Response Timeline
- Discovery Date: March 15, 2025
- Reported to MSRC: March 22, 2025
- Patch Released: May 11, 2025 (Patch Tuesday)
- Public Disclosure: May 14, 2025
Mitigation Strategies
Organizations should immediately:
- Apply the latest Power Pages updates
- Review all user roles and permissions
- Audit API access logs for suspicious activity
- Implement additional network-level controls
- Monitor Microsoft's security advisories for updates
Long-Term Security Considerations
This incident highlights several important lessons for SaaS security:
- The need for continuous access control validation
- Importance of API security in low-code platforms
- Challenges of maintaining security in rapidly evolving cloud services
Microsoft has announced plans to enhance Power Pages' security framework, including:
- Stricter session validation protocols
- Improved API security testing
- More granular permission controls
Expert Recommendations
Security professionals advise:
- Implementing zero-trust principles for Power Platform environments
- Regular security assessments of low-code applications
- Employee training on proper Power Platform configuration
- Considering third-party security tools for additional protection
As cloud-based development platforms become more prevalent, vulnerabilities like CVE-2025-24989 serve as important reminders about the shared responsibility model in cloud security.